| +#ifndef CHROMEOS_NETWORK_NETWORK_TYPE_PATTERN_H_
|
| +#define CHROMEOS_NETWORK_NETWORK_TYPE_PATTERN_H_
|
| +
|
| +#include <string>
|
| +
|
| +#include "base/macros.h"
|
| +#include "chromeos/chromeos_export.h"
|
| +
|
| +namespace chromeos {
|
| +
|
| +class CHROMEOS_EXPORT NetworkTypePattern {
|
| + public:
|
| + // Matches any network.
|
| + static NetworkTypePattern Default();
|
| +
|
| + // Matches wireless (WiFi, cellular, etc.) networks
|
| + static NetworkTypePattern Wireless();
|
| +
|
| + // Matches cellular or wimax networks.
|
| + static NetworkTypePattern Mobile();
|
| +
|
| + // Matches non virtual networks.
|
| + static NetworkTypePattern NonVirtual();
|
| +
|
| + // Matches ethernet networks (with or without EAP).
|
| + static NetworkTypePattern Ethernet();
|
| +
|
| + static NetworkTypePattern WiFi();
|
| + static NetworkTypePattern Cellular();
|
| + static NetworkTypePattern VPN();
|
| + static NetworkTypePattern Wimax();
|
| +
|
| + // Matches only networks of exactly the type |shill_network_type|, which must
|
| + // be one of the types defined in service_constants.h (e.g.
|
| + // shill::kTypeWifi).
|
| + // Note: Shill distinguishes Ethernet without EAP from Ethernet with EAP. If
|
| + // unsure, better use one of the matchers above.
|
| + static NetworkTypePattern Primitive(const std::string& shill_network_type);
|
| +
|
| + bool Equals(const NetworkTypePattern& other) const;
|
| + bool MatchesType(const std::string& shill_network_type) const;
|
| +
|
| + // Returns true if this pattern matches at least one network type that
|
| + // |other_pattern| matches (according to MatchesType). Thus MatchesPattern is
|
| + // symmetric and reflexive but not transitive.
|
| + // See the unit test for examples.
|
| + bool MatchesPattern(const NetworkTypePattern& other_pattern) const;
|
| +
|
| + std::string ToDebugString() const;
|
| +
|
| + private:
|
| + explicit NetworkTypePattern(int pattern);
|
| +
|
| + // The bit array of the matching network types.
|
| + int pattern_;
|
| +
|
| + DISALLOW_ASSIGN(NetworkTypePattern);
|
| +};
|
| +
|
| +} // namespace chromeos
|
| +
|
| +#endif // CHROMEOS_NETWORK_NETWORK_TYPE_PATTERN_H_
